New Japan ran Day 3 of Best Of The Super Junior 33 today in Tokyo.
Today’s event was held at Yoyogi National Stadium Gym 2 in Tokyo and can be watched on demand on New Japan World.
The announced paid attendance was 1664.
All matches were Best Of The Super Junior matches.
Match 1: Block A: Titan beat Daiki Nagai.
Match 2: Block B: Yoshinobu Kanemaru beat Jacob Austion Young.
Match 3: Block A: Ryusuke Taguchi beat Valiente Jr. by ref stoppage in 49 seconds. Potential Valiente knee injury.
Match 4: Block B: Sho beat KUSHIDA.
Match 5: Block A: Francesco Akira beat Nick Wayne.
Match 6: Block B: Daisuke Sasaki beat Hyo.
Match 7: Block A: Master Wato beat Robbie X.
Match 8: Block B: Yoh beat Taiji Ishimori.
Match 9: Block A: Jun Kasai beat Kosei Fujita.
Main Event: Block B: Robbie Eagles beat El Desperado.
Standings:
Block A:
1-Taguchi, 3-0, 6 pts
2-Titan, 3-0, 6 pts
3-Fujita, 2-1, 4 pts
4-Kasai, 1-1, 2 pts
5-Valiente, 1-1, 2 pts
6-Akira, 1-2, 2 pts
7-Wayne, 1-2, 2 pts
8-Wato, 1-2, 2 pts
9-X, 1-2, 2 pts
10-Nagai, 0-3, 0 pts
Block B:
1-Sho, 3-0, 6 pts
2-Sasaki, 3-0, 6 pts
3-Yoh, 2-1, 4 pts
4-Hyo, 1-1, 2 pts
5-Kanemaru, 1-2, 2 pts
6-KUSHIDA, 1-2, 2 pts
7-Ishimori, 1-2, 2 pts
8-Eagles, 1-2, 2 pts
9-Desperado, 1-2, 2 pts
10-Young, 0-3, 0 pts
The top 2 in each block advance to the Semifinals.
